ObjectId是Core Data 为每一个数据对象提供的唯一ID标识,获取ObjectID、并打印的方法如下:步骤:1. 获取ManagedObject2. ManagedObject -> ObjectID3. ObjectId -> URL4. URL -> String NS...
分类:
其他好文 时间:
2015-08-13 01:02:52
阅读次数:
179
/** ?? ? *数据持久化的四种方式 ?? ? * ?? ? *1-------属性列表 ?? ? * ?? ? *2-------对象归档 ?? ? * ?? ? *3-------SQLite3 ?? ? * ?? ? *4-------Core Data ?? ? * ?? ? ...
分类:
其他好文 时间:
2015-08-12 23:47:02
阅读次数:
423
iOS 4种讲数据持久存储到iOS文件的系统机制:属性列表(NSUserDefaults、plist文件)对象归档(NSCoding)iOS嵌入式关系数据库(SQLite3)苹果提供的持久化工具(Core Data)说道数据持久化都涉及到一个共同的要素。既然是把数据持久存储到iOS文件系统中,那么久...
分类:
移动开发 时间:
2015-08-05 00:30:25
阅读次数:
183
超长慎入列表: DZNEmptyDataSet(UI,空表格视图解算器) PDTSimpleCalendar(UI,drop-in日历组件) MagicalRecord(实施活跃记录模式的Core ? ? ?Data助手) Chameleon(UI,色彩框架) Alamofire(Swift 网...
分类:
移动开发 时间:
2015-07-28 13:18:24
阅读次数:
183
DZNEmptyDataSet(UI,空表格视图解算器)PDTSimpleCalendar(UI,drop-in日历组件)MagicalRecord(实施活跃记录模式的Core Data助手)Chameleon(UI,色彩框架)Alamofire(Swift 网络)TextFieldEffects ...
分类:
移动开发 时间:
2015-07-27 10:49:59
阅读次数:
174
一、概述 CoreData是一个用于数据持久化的框架,Core Data支持4种类型的数据存储:SQLiteStore, XMLStore, BinaryStore, InMemoryStore。 注意:CoreData大部分情况下是基于SQLite数据库进行数据管理的,所以以下全部是其基于SQ.....
分类:
其他好文 时间:
2015-07-26 22:25:18
阅读次数:
213
27个提升效率的iOS开源库推荐DZNEmptyDataSet(UI,空表格视图解算器) PDTSimpleCalendar(UI,drop-in日历组件) MagicalRecord(实施活跃记录模式的Core Data助手) Chameleon(UI,色彩框架) Alamofire(Swift ...
分类:
移动开发 时间:
2015-07-24 18:10:47
阅读次数:
158
项目使用缓存三种方式最好:
URL缓存、数据模型缓存(利用NSKeyedArchiver)和数据库
假设你正在开发一个应用,需要缓存数据以改善应用表现出的性能,你应该实现按需缓存(使用数据模型缓存或URL缓存)。另一方面,如果需要数据能够离线访问,而且具有合理的存储方式以便离线编辑,那么就用高级序列化技术(如Core Data)。
URL缓存应该属于内存缓存,下一次开启页面实际上...
分类:
其他好文 时间:
2015-07-22 13:17:02
阅读次数:
107
注意:每次修改CoreData的Attribute时记得把应用给删除重装,要不会崩,因为建立的数据库文件还在该目录下,里面的字段没有更改,所以不能匹配就会崩溃,切忌,要不就每次进来把文件先删除,再建立,不过貌似这样做用户的数据就会丢失,所以还是每次删除应用再装吧。😓1.先建立一个coredata的...
分类:
其他好文 时间:
2015-07-17 18:41:49
阅读次数:
170
Core DataCore Data是iOS5之后才出现的一个框架,它提供了对象-关系映射(ORM)的功能,即能够将OC对象转化成数据,保存在SQLite数据库文件中,也能够将保存在数据库中的数据还原成OC对象。在此数据操作期间,我们不需要编写任何SQL语句,这个有点类似于著名的Hibernate持久化框架,不过功能肯定是没有Hibernate强大的。传统的数据库要把数据写到数据库,而且要写SQL语...
分类:
移动开发 时间:
2015-07-17 09:44:33
阅读次数:
275